Output 1e8a2e95fb48915f612594167ffce334d15376973849b3ea7f512c039dfb3493:3

value
342591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e6efc2025b66a4ffc68363c9894fd229cbbe23 OP_EQUAL
address
3CAZcAYzvFvZQkfYe6HMeDRAhZNwwpCw96
transaction
1e8a2e95fb48915f612594167ffce334d15376973849b3ea7f512c039dfb3493
spent
true